Acceptance of Sharīʿah‐compliant precious metal‐backed cryptocurrency as an alternative currency: An empirical validation of adoption of innovation theory
Authors:Mousa Ajouz  Adam Abdullah  Salina Kassim
Abstract:In the crypto world, there is a proverbial (and literal) gold rush now occurring. Currently, more than 37 gold‐backed cryptocurrency companies have now emerged. Interestingly, some of them also claim to be Sharī?ah‐compliant. Introducing precious metal‐backed cryptocurrencies is perceived to be an innovation among global payment systems, hampered in part by lack of supporting empirical evidence. Therefore, this research investigates potential users' tendency to adopt a Sharī?ah‐compliant precious metal‐backed cryptocurrency. As such, this study adopts an extended adoption model, which consists of eight factors. Partial least squares structural equation modeling (PLS‐SEM) analysis was conducted on data elicited from economic active residents in Klang Valley from questionnaires. Overall, it was found six out of the eight constructs specified to influence the adoption of precious metal‐backed cryptocurrency were statistically significant where 54.5% of the variation in adoption of PMBC can be explained by the structure model provided by this research. It was also found 63.55% of the respondents are willing to adopt precious metal‐backed cryptocurrency in their future transactions.
